Udaipur, March 25: Bollywood actor Sunny Deol, known for his iconic "ढाई किलो का हाथ" dialogue, is returning to the big screen after 18 months. His last film, Gadar 2, created a storm at the box office, and it looks like he is ready to make a big impact in theatres once again. This time, he will do so with his new film, 'Jaat'. A few months ago, the makers released a short teaser, which was loved by the fans. Now, the trailer of the film has also been released.

Sunny Deol, Randeep Hooda's 'Jaat' Trailer Released

The trailer begins with a chilling scene showing several dead bodies. The police ask the villagers what happened, but everyone remains silent out of fear - a typical Bollywood flick response. A child finally speaks up and says that Ranatunga is behind it all. This introduces the main villain, played by Randeep Hooda, who is a ruthless killer and a devil in human form.

Then, Sunny Deol’s character, Jaat, makes a powerful entry. He is shown to have the strength to take down his enemies with just one punch or slap. Jaat comes to put an end to the atrocities faced by the villagers and confronts Randeep Hooda's character. Sunny performs some incredible action scenes that leave everyone in awe, and the trailer’s intense title track adds to the excitement.

Sunny Deol and Randeep Hooda dominate the entire trailer. Vineet Kumar Singh from Chhava also appears during the intense clash of the main protagonist and antagonist. After the iconic hand pump scene in Gadar, Sunny is now seen uprooting a fan and using it to defeat his enemies. Toward the end of the trailer, Sunny delivers his iconic "ढाई किलो का हाथ" dialogue in a new way: “The whole North has seen the power of this ढाई किलो का हाथ, now the South will see it.

The film is directed by renowned South Indian director Gopichand Malineni. Along with Sunny Deol and Randeep Hooda, the cast includes Vineet Kumar Singh, Saiyami Kher, Regina Cassandra, Ramya Krishnan, and Jagapathi Babu. Jaat is set to release in theatres on April 10 in Hindi and other languages.
